BioCNG

We currently use 100% of the biogas produced by our digester as fuel for the engine that is coupled to our 1060 kW generator.  Increased biogas production from our current tank (or second tank) could be utilized in many different ways.  One of the utilizations RAKR is exploring is BioCNG (Compressed Natural Gas).  The BioCNG would be used by CNG vehicles on the farm and possibly as the fuel we burn in our grain dryer.  As our ability to produce this fuel could greatly exceed the total farm usage, we would be looking for another environmentally conscious business that is looking to replace diesel fuel with CNG.
